
西工大C语言精讲:基础语法与程序设计
下载需积分: 9 | 2.2MB |
更新于2024-07-27
| 38 浏览量 | 举报
收藏
"西工大c语言课件1-4章是西北工业大学基于清华出版的C语言教材制作的课件,涵盖了C语言的基础知识,包括C语言概述、数据类型、运算符与表达式、顺序程序设计等内容。课程注重理论与实践结合,采用精讲多练的教学模式,旨在培养学生的计算思维能力和程序设计技能。实验环节使用Code::Blocks作为开发环境,通过实验和课程设计提升学生实际操作能力。考核方式包括理论成绩和实验成绩,理论成绩主要由平时成绩和期末机试组成,实验成绩则依赖于POJ在线评测和课程设计项目。"
在C语言的学习中,第一章C语言概述介绍了C语言的历史背景和特点。C语言是一种强大的编程语言,它具有高效、简洁、灵活的特性,广泛应用于系统编程、应用软件开发、嵌入式系统等领域。1.1部分讲解了C语言的出现是如何在计算机语言发展历史中占据重要地位的,以及它相对于其他语言的优势。接着,1.2部分简单介绍了C程序的基本结构,让学生对C语言程序有个初步的认识。1.3部分详细阐述了编写、编译、链接和运行C程序的步骤,这是学习任何编程语言的基础。
第二章至第四章深入讲解了C语言的核心概念。第3章数据类型、运算符与表达式是理解程序逻辑的关键,包括基本数据类型(如整型、浮点型、字符型)、运算符(算术、关系、逻辑等)以及表达式的求值规则。第4章则介绍了最简单的程序设计形式——顺序结构,学生将学会如何通过组合基本语句来实现简单的程序流程。
课程的实验部分不仅要求学生掌握开发工具的使用,还要熟悉程序调试技巧,通过POJ在线评测平台进行实战练习,提高编程能力。课程设计项目则鼓励学生运用所学知识解决实际问题,如科学计算、图形绘制或多媒体处理,以提升综合应用技能。
这个课程设计全面,注重实践,旨在帮助学生快速掌握C语言的基础,并为后续的高级编程打下坚实的基础。通过这样的学习,学生不仅能理解C语言的语法,还能培养出良好的编程习惯和计算思维能力。
相关推荐






a892503185
- 粉丝: 0
最新资源
- 谭浩强版C++编程实操题解及上机指导
- 华为J2EE面试题大揭秘,网络试题解析
- 《计算机与网络英汉大词典》专业词典下载
- C#委托应用实例解析
- SwiSHmax:创新的Flash动画编辑工具
- 全面掌握SQL Server 2005:培训教程与面试题解析
- DB2在Linux系统上的安装与基本使用指南
- 优化后的红色模板:hzhost5.2版本完善指南
- C#.NET开发OA系统核心功能与应用
- 后台系统美工与功能评测
- J2ME编程教程:权威指南与IBM专家经验分享
- AJAX-ValidatorCallout控件的简易使用示例
- 美观实用的JS日期时间选择器介绍
- 压缩包子文件处理技术介绍
- JDK1.6重点新特性深入分析与应用
- MySQL参考手册详细解析关键字功能与常见问题
- 扩展 eclipse 代码折叠功能的 myeclipse 插件
- ASP.NET实现具地区查询功能的留言板系统
- wodig 4 源代码分析与文件压缩技术
- 全面解析TreeListView控件在C#中的应用技巧
- 深入了解SSH框架集成:Struts+Spring+Hibernate实战案例
- 深入解析Windows驱动程序模型设计源代码
- 轻松验证数据完整性:md5/SHA/CRC哈希工具
- C/C++函数库参考大全(chm中文版)